Today was my first day at boxing class. I've been really wanting to learn how to box for some time now. I used to tell myself I was too out of shape to try it and that once I was sub 280lbs, I would give it a go. Well, I'm down to 300ish and not really in shape but I figure if I don't do it now, I'll be kicking myself later.
So, I found a boxing gym that didn't mind having foreigners join up. The owner/coach doesn't really speak English but he gets his point across well enough for me to understand. And one thing he did make clear from the beginning is that I need to lose weight.
Here's how it went:
-Cardio, treadmill for twenty minutes.
-Stretching
-Jumping Jacks
-Practiced breathing technique
-learned how to wrap my wrist wraps. (This going to take practice.)
-Punching bag
Standing in front of the bag with my legs shoulder width apart. I punched with my left hand, then right hand, working on rotating my hips as I punched. I hit the bag 70 times for 9 sets. Pretty much by the 2nd set my arms were aching and I was winded. In between sets I would practice the breathing I learned earlier.
